When I flush my toilet it gurgles?

The cause of your toilet gurgling is a blocked line somewhere. A clog is creating negative air pressure, Instead of air flowing through the lines,the air pushes back and causes the gurgling sound. Sometimes, you'll also see the toilet water bubble.

How do you fix a toilet that gurgles when flushed?

  1. First, try plunging the toilet after sealing off the drains in nearby sinks, showers, and tubs.
  2. Call your neighbors to see if they, too, have bubbles coming out of the toilet.
  3. Snake the drain to remove tougher clogs.
  4. Check and clear the vent stack.
  5. Call the plumber if your toilet bubbles despite these best efforts.

Does a gurgling toilet mean septic tank is full?

Your pipes may begin to make gurgling noises. The noise will become audible when you run the water or flush the toilet. This is a sign that the tank is full and needs to be pumped. The gurgling results from the septic tank being too full of solids and not being able to function properly.

How do I know if my main line is clogged?

Here are a few signs that it's your main line that's clogged.
  1. Multiple slow-running drains. If more than one drain is running slow, it's probably not a coincidence, but an indication that one clog is causing issues for all of them. ...
  2. Water backing up into other drains. ...
  3. Gurgling sounds. ...
  4. Sewage odors coming from the drains.

How do you tell if you have a clogged pipe or full septic tank?

How can you tell if your septic tank is full?
  1. You have trouble flushing your toilet, or it's constantly backing up. ...
  2. Your pipes make a gurgling sound or drain very slowly. ...
  3. Your lawn is suddenly growing lush, green grass. ...
  4. Water starts to pool in your yard. ...
  5. Your home or yard smells like… well, sewage.
